Output ebfc36d449cbe7cf912dd3ee15bbdfa081a253a5b945f616a0b7bb3f42af5916:0

value
18180000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e598751b0bcce375952ae4be9eea581c41dd9f49 OP_EQUALVERIFY OP_CHECKSIG
address
1MvzNrmaEsAJyqPYaYh2LLHtwDuNEAj8uV
transaction
ebfc36d449cbe7cf912dd3ee15bbdfa081a253a5b945f616a0b7bb3f42af5916
confirmations
688494
spent
true